Dublin Docklands
The Liam Carroll-built skeletal structure shown here has become synonymous with Ireland's crashed property development market.
Earlier this year the state owned Anglo Irish Bank formally ended its agreement to occupy the bank’s proposed new headquarters in the north Dublin docklands.
The bank has withdrawn from its pre-agreed option to lease the property, confirming expectations that Anglo would never occupy the building.
